Output ebc96d2bcd26e87f2821c980d4eea8f82b1a91c8dd6e078e62dc7726a1f144d7:0

value
1004566
script pubkey
OP_0 OP_PUSHBYTES_20 685f98c3935780c65a1b1c972da5b0820bab16be
address
bc1qdp0e3sun27qvvksmrjtjmfdssg96k947fzv0ad
transaction
ebc96d2bcd26e87f2821c980d4eea8f82b1a91c8dd6e078e62dc7726a1f144d7
confirmations
192210
spent
true